A forecaster found that wind slabs at Heather Meadows were stubborn to trigger avalanches on during their outing on Thursday. They also intentionally avoided large, steep, slopes that had obvious wind loading and rolled over into even steeper terrain beneath them, as they highly suspected that entering that terrain would have resulted in a large, destructive avalanche (observation). Avalanches may be more difficult to trigger than previous days, but this doesn't mean you won't trigger one if you're in the right spot.
Search for wind-affected snow. Wind slabs may be smooth and rounded, or they could have a textured surface. These areas will feel firmer beneath you than softer, non wind-affected snow. Slabs frequently develop in gullies, on the leeward side of ridges and features, and around outcroppings. Look for obvious clues like long, shooting cracks, and dig small hand pits to see how easily the heavier, wind-affected layer slides over the softer snow beneath it. Avoid steep slopes where you encounter wind slabs, and especially if you find obvious clues of concern.
